Course content
1. creation of permanent preparations 2. dissection of earthworms and snails 3. dissection of cockroach and mouse 4. observation in Drosophila 5. creation of a geological profile 6. measuring the slope and direction of the strata - plotting on a map 7. recognising rocks in the field 8. working with a geological map

Learning outcomes
Learn microscopic zoological techniques and use dissections to reinforce the anatomy of individual representatives of selected animal tribes. To become familiar with a geological map to identify basic rock types.
Theoretical knowledge and practical skills in the field.
